Agartala, Nov. 2 -- Tripura government has again sought an extension of two weeks from the Supreme Court to submit its response to a writ petition regarding the long-overdue elections for the Village Committees under the Tripura Tribal Areas Autonomous District Council (TTAADC).
Earlier, the Advocate for the State of Tripura informed the apex judiciary that additional time is needed to secure "complete instructions" from the government before filing their official reply. The case is scheduled for a hearing tomorrow in the bench comprising Chief Justice of India B R Gaavai and Justice K Vinod Chandran, but again, the state asked for two weeks.
